The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Gloucester local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 16 TEAL CLOSE sales from December 2006 and December 2013 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the December 2006 sale was for 12%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 12% below the HPI over time, until the December 2013 sale, where it falls to 14%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 14% below the HPI.
16 TEAL CLOSE might now be worth an estimated £353,344.
This is based on house price inflation of 78.9%, between December 2013 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Gloucester local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).
The 78.9%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 16 TEAL CLOSE of £197,500 on 13th December 2013. For the value to have increased from £197,500 to £353,344 over the twelve years and ten months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:
